Omemee senior pronounced dead following Highway 7 collision

An Omemee senior has died following a head-on collision on Highway 7 Tuesday (Nov. 2) afternoon.

According to the OPP, emergency personnel were called to the scene, just east of Omemee, around 2:15 p.m.

The collision involved a SUV and a sedan, police noted.

Elsie Lees, 78, was pronounced dead at the scene. The other driver was taken to hospital with non-life threatening injuries.

The highway was closed for several hours for a police investigation.
